Personal Information Aggregator for Privacy-Controlled Data Integration
Find Innovative SolutionsGenerate Solutions
Solution Overview
Problem
Current systems lack an efficient and user-centric method for aggregating and managing personal information across various sources, leading to fragmented data access and control, which hinders personalized recommendations and targeted advertising.
Innovation Solution
A Personal Information Aggregator (PIA) system that collects, organizes, and controls personal information from diverse sources, allowing users to authorize access and configure data feeds, enabling comprehensive data aggregation and targeted applications such as personalized recommendations and advertising.

Engineering Contradiction Analysis
1Quantity of substance
If personal information is aggregated from multiple sources, then the comprehensiveness of data is improved, but the complexity of data management increases
Solution Approach 1:
The patent introduces a Personal Information Aggregator (PIA) as an intermediary system that automatically collects, consolidates, and manages personal information from multiple sources (banks, employers, insurance companies, etc.). The PIA serves as a mediator between users and diverse data sources, handling the complexity of data aggregation, standardization, and management while providing users with a simplified interface to access their comprehensive personal information profile.
2Reliability
If users have centralized control over personal information, then privacy protection is improved, but the ease of access to data decreases
Solution Approach 1:
The patent implements a self-service mechanism where users directly control access to their personal information through the PIA. Users can selectively authorize which entities (employers, insurers, lenders) may access specific portions of their information profile. The system automatically manages consent, tracking, and revocation of access permissions, enabling users to maintain centralized privacy control without manual intervention for each data access request.
3Measurement precision
If data is collected from diverse sources, then the accuracy of personalized recommendations is improved, but the difficulty of data integration increases
Solution Approach 1:
The patent transforms heterogeneous data from diverse sources into a standardized information profile by changing the parameters and format of collected data. The PIA normalizes different data structures, schemas, and formats from various sources (banks, employers, insurers) into a unified personal information profile with consistent parameters. This parameter standardization enables accurate personalized recommendations while automating the complex data integration process.

A computer-implemented method for generating an assessment of insurance needs for an individual includes receiving one or more data feeds comprising personal information corresponding to the individual. The received data feeds are associated with an authorization condition requiring deletion of the received data feeds by the computer after a single use. A personal identifier associated with the individual is determined based on the received data feeds and search of a public computer network is requested for data items having an indicia of the personal identifier. In response to the search of the public computer network, an indication of a first data item is received. The first data item is automatically retrieved from a remote location in response to receiving the indication and an assessment of insurance needs for the individual is generated based at least on a portion of the received data feeds and the first data item.
